Explore the UNESCO World Heritage-listed Giant’s Causeway and other top attractions in Northern Ireland on this full-day tour from Belfast! Journeying in a luxury coach, you’ll visit Carrickfergus Castle, Carnlough Harbour, the Caves at Cushendun, Giant’s Causeway, Carrick-a-rede Ropebridge, Dunluce Castle, and The Dark Hedges.

This was a long day. Our... - This was a long day. Our guide, whose name I think was Robert, was absolutely amazing and full of information. Despite the tour starting at 8:30am we arrived at 8am and found the bus totally full so couldn’t sit together. Which isn’t a huge deal we were just surprised that many people arrived early! I actually ended up with a really nice seat view. The first couple stops are relatively small and largely for bathroom breaks, but both locations were those I would never have seen otherwise. The drive up the Antrim Coast was spectacular. That was one of the most gorgeous drives I’ve ever been on. Lunch was well organized. Having done three day trips by now I can definitely say this was the most well organized lunch stop. The main event was of course Giant’s Causeway and it was a beautiful day for it. Our guide was good to mention there was a shuttle bus we could take back up to the top. Our remaining stops were mostly short but I loved the visit to Bushmills Distillery. We had enough time for a quick whiskey flight which was really fun. We got back to Belfast right on time. And you can’t beat this tour on price.
